.draft-cta__container{width:0;flex-shrink:0;position:relative;padding-left:0}@media (min-width:1024px){.draft-cta__container{width:420px;padding-left:38px}}.draft-cta__content{position:sticky;top:104px;left:0}.draft-cta__inner{width:100%;display:flex;flex-direction:column;gap:20px;padding:28px 32px 24px 40px;border-radius:24px}.draft-cta__inner__complete{gap:28px}.ptv_embla{max-width:calc(100vw - 2rem);display:flex;flex-direction:column;@media (min-width:1024px){max-width:620px}}.embla__viewport.ptv{overflow:hidden}.ptv_embla___container{display:flex}.ptv_embla___slide{margin-right:8px}.embla__buttons.ptv{display:flex;gap:1rem}.embla__buttons.ptv .embla__button{width:1.25rem;height:1.25rem;border:none;opacity:.5}.embla{max-width:100%;--slide-height:19rem;--slide-spacing:1rem;--slide-size:70%;display:flex;flex-direction:column;gap:2rem}.embla__viewport-wrapper{position:relative}.embla__viewport{overflow:hidden}.embla__next-arrow{position:absolute;right:4px;top:50%;transform:translateY(-50%);z-index:2;width:36px;height:36px;border-radius:50%;background:hsla(0,0%,7%,.35);backdrop-filter:blur(6px);border:none;color:hsla(0,0%,100%,.45);display:flex;align-items:center;justify-content:center;cursor:pointer;transition:color .2s,background .2s}.embla__next-arrow:hover{color:hsla(0,0%,100%,.65);background:hsla(0,0%,7%,.5)}.embla__next-arrow:before{content:"";position:absolute;left:-64px;top:0;bottom:0;width:64px;background:linear-gradient(90deg,transparent,rgba(9,11,11,.25) 60%,hsla(0,0%,7%,.35));pointer-events:none}.embla__container{backface-visibility:hidden;display:flex;touch-action:pan-y pinch-zoom;margin-left:calc(var(--slide-spacing) * -1);gap:20px;padding-left:1rem}.embla__slide{flex:0 0 var(--slide-size);min-width:0;padding-left:var(--slide-spacing)}.embla__slide__number{box-shadow:inset 0 0 0 .2rem var(--detail-medium-contrast);border-radius:1.8rem;font-size:4rem;font-weight:600;display:flex;align-items:center;justify-content:center;height:var(--slide-height)}.embla__controls{display:none;@media (min-width:1024px){display:flex;justify-content:flex-end;align-items:center}}.embla__buttons{display:grid;grid-template-columns:repeat(2,1fr);gap:.6rem;align-items:center}.embla__button{-webkit-tap-highlight-color:rgba(var(--text-high-contrast-rgb-value),.5);-webkit-appearance:none;appearance:none;background-color:transparent;touch-action:manipulation;display:inline-flex;text-decoration:none;cursor:pointer;padding:0;margin:0;box-shadow:inset 0 0 0 .2rem var(--detail-medium-contrast);width:3rem;height:3rem;z-index:var(--z-carousel);border-radius:50%;color:var(--text-body);display:flex;align-items:center;justify-content:center}.embla__button:disabled{color:var(--detail-high-contrast)}.embla__button__svg{width:35%;height:35%}.embla__dots{display:flex;flex-wrap:wrap;justify-content:center;align-items:center;margin-right:calc((6px - 1.4rem) / 2 * -1);gap:10px;@media (min-width:1024px){display:none}}.embla__dot{-webkit-tap-highlight-color:rgba(255,255,255,.7);-webkit-appearance:none;appearance:none;background-color:transparent;touch-action:manipulation;display:inline-flex;text-decoration:none;cursor:pointer;border:0;padding:0;margin:0;justify-content:center}.embla__dot,.embla__dot:after{width:6px;height:6px;display:flex;align-items:center;border-radius:50%}.embla__dot:after{box-shadow:inset 0 0 0 .2rem hsla(0,0%,100%,.3);content:""}.embla__dot--selected:after{box-shadow:inset 0 0 0 .2rem hsla(0,0%,100%,.7)}.operators-embla{--slide-size:calc(100% / 4)}@media (max-width:1023px){.operators-embla{--slide-size:70%}}.operators-container{touch-action:pan-x pinch-zoom}.operator-item,.operators-slide{display:flex;align-items:center;justify-content:center}.operator-item{flex-direction:column;gap:.75rem;width:100%;min-height:120px}.operator-item img{width:auto;height:auto;max-width:150px;max-height:80px;object-fit:contain}.operator-item span{font-size:.875rem;text-align:center;color:var(--color-white)}.travel-confidence-embla{--slide-size:70%}@media (min-width:1024px){.travel-confidence-embla{--slide-size:25%}}.travel-confidence-container{touch-action:pan-x pinch-zoom}.travel-confidence-slide{display:flex;align-items:stretch}.reviews-embla{--slide-size:100%;--slide-spacing:1rem}@media (min-width:768px){.reviews-embla{--slide-size:calc((100% - var(--slide-spacing) * 2) / 3)}}.reviews-container{touch-action:pan-x pinch-zoom}.reviews-slide{padding-left:var(--slide-spacing)}.instagram-embla{--slide-size:85%;--slide-spacing:1rem}@media (min-width:640px){.instagram-next-arrow{display:none}.instagram-embla{--slide-size:calc((100% - var(--slide-spacing) * 2) / 3)}}.instagram-container{touch-action:pan-x pinch-zoom}.instagram-slide{padding-left:var(--slide-spacing)}.instagram-card{max-width:360px;margin:0 auto}.instagram-swipe-overlay{position:relative;width:100%;height:100%}.instagram-swipe-edges{position:absolute;inset:0;z-index:1;pointer-events:none;touch-action:pan-x}.instagram-swipe-edges:after,.instagram-swipe-edges:before{content:"";position:absolute;top:0;bottom:0;width:20%;pointer-events:auto}.instagram-swipe-edges:before{left:0}.instagram-swipe-edges:after{right:0}.what-you-see-embla.embla{max-width:100%}.what-you-see-embla .embla__container.what-you-see-container{touch-action:pan-x pinch-zoom;margin-left:0;padding-left:0;gap:1rem}.what-you-see-embla .embla__slide.what-you-see-slide{flex:0 0 min(360px,92vw);min-width:0;padding-left:0}@media (min-width:1024px){.what-you-see-embla .embla__slide.what-you-see-slide{flex:0 0 calc((100% - 2rem) / 3)}}.what-you-see-embla.embla .embla__dots.what-you-see-embla__dots{display:flex!important}.AdditionalQuestions_toggleButton__ZUl_T{width:fit-content;position:relative;display:flex;flex-direction:row;flex-wrap:wrap;align-items:center;justify-content:center;gap:4px;border:1px solid transparent;background-color:var(--color-black);background-clip:padding-box;padding:12px 24px;border-radius:24px}.AdditionalQuestions_toggleButton__ZUl_T:after{position:absolute;top:-1px;bottom:-1px;left:-1px;right:-1px;background:linear-gradient(90deg,#afbd77,#ffbc4f);content:"";z-index:-1;border-radius:24px}.ReservationWidget_container__5enx_{display:flex;flex-direction:column;gap:24px;background-color:var(--color-gray-900);padding:32px;border-radius:16px}.ReservationWidget_separator__8vayI{border-bottom:1px solid var(--color-gray-800)}.TourFeatureCard_container__Txas9{display:grid;grid-template-columns:48px 1fr;gap:16px}.filter-modal__checkbox{color:#fff;font-size:14px;line-height:20px;display:flex;align-items:center;gap:12px;cursor:pointer}.filter-modal__checkbox.gap-2{gap:8px}.custom-checkbox{width:20px;height:20px;-webkit-appearance:none;appearance:none;background-color:transparent;cursor:pointer;background-image:url(/_next/static/media/checkbox.0146c8bc.svg)}.custom-checkbox:checked{background-image:url(/_next/static/media/checkbox-checked.e8f0e6be.svg)}.custom-radio{width:20px;height:20px;-webkit-appearance:none;appearance:none;background-color:transparent;cursor:pointer;border:2px solid #6b7280;border-radius:50%}.custom-radio:checked{background-color:#22c55e;border-color:#22c55e;box-shadow:inset 0 0 0 3px #000}
/*# sourceMappingURL=c403783e8a486a82.css.map*/